I do not claim to be any kind of an expert in this subject. I do claim that I can run both DOOM, and DOOM2 under OS2 Warp. My system is a Packard Bell Force 102CD, with 16 meg RAM, a 90Mhz CPU, I run OS2 Warp with WIN/OS2 support, using HPFS exclusively. I use a native OS2 sound driver for my sound card which I got from Packard Bell (they gave me excellent support upgrading to OS2 Warp from the Microsoft OS of the day) and installed. Video is run at SVGA Mode, giving me seamless windows support. These settings I arrived at by constantly tinkering with the settings. Regretfully, I cannot get full sound, and I cannot get the Joy Stick to work, either with or without the OS2 Joy Stick driver in the OS2 config.sys file. If you tweak and find better settings, especially for sound, please let me know. You must set your DOOM setup with keyboard and mouse, no joy stick, and use music for you're sound card, but sound effects must be set for your PC speaker to work.
Although the sound is crappy, the video is excellent, and the game is enjoyable.
